what to do with leftover chicken
I made NQ's crockpot chicken on Tuesday night and I have about half of it leftover for tonight - probably 1-1.5 pounds of white meat. I should have cooked it upside down - the breast meat was a little dry so I don't want to eat it by itself again.
What should I make with it? no quesadillas and DH does not like chicken soup (the horror). I don't have time to run to the store tonight
I also have some leftover mashed potatoes...which by the way were amazing. I added some Helluva good french onion dip to them instead of butter and milk. You need to try this. Definitely not the healthiest move, but damnnn.
Re: what to do with leftover chicken
Chicken pot pie or some sort of casserole. I make a chicken casserole with noodles, cream of mushroom soup, cheese, veggies etc... It's tasty and a WW reciper
I wonder if you could make a shepards pie with chicken and use your potatoes. Of course it wouldn't be shepards pie then, but thinking on those lines.
My husband doesn't like chicken noodle soup either. He is a very picky eater, I blame his mother for catering to this
I made chicken salad with my leftover chicken and had that for lunch for about three days. I don't use a recipe for my chicken salad, I just toss in whatever I have: mayo/greek yogurt, apple, grapes, nuts, onion, celery, craisins...curry is really good in fruity chicken salad.
Chicken a la King is another good option. DH makes this from time to time. It's not the prettiest meal but it tastes pretty good.
